Webb23 mars 2024 · What is Lean? Lean is a philosophical way of working that emphasizes the removal of waste within a process. At its core is the principle that expenditure of resources for any goal other than the creation of value for the end customer is wasteful and therefore should be a target for elimination. Webb9 mars 2024 · Defining ethics. Rushworth Kidder states that "standard definitions of ethics have typically included such phrases as 'the science of the ideal human character' or 'the science of moral duty'". Taoism, like Confucianism, rests on the concept of harmonic order in nature and society.Both Confucius and Lao-Tze shared the concept of Tao but Taoism differed considerably from Confucianism since it sought enlightenment in ultimate, rather than inner-worldly principles of cosmic order.
